Lot 128

SIGNED XI TANG (CHINESE)
BOOK OF TWELVE CHINESE LANDSCAPE PAINTINGS, LATE QING DYNASTY TO REPUBLIC PERIOD














Auction: Brushes Across Empire | Wed 11th March from 10am | Lots 1 to 179
Description
清末民初 西塘款 山水圖十二幀 行書題跋兩幀 水墨設色紙本 冊頁
跋:…歲在庚子秋日畫於長安客舍之雲窗下。闕里孔西塘墨跡
鈐印:西、塘、知足
ink and light colour on paper, with inscriptions, seals and signature, dated to Geng Zi year, a book of twelve album paintings bound together
Dimensions
31.5cm x 21cm each leaf
Provenance
Acquired by Sir James Stewart Lockhart (1858-1937) from a resident of Lincun, Wendeng District, Shandong Province, November 1912 for HK £12, (Sir James Stewart Lockhart, Notebook, dated 1910-1921, p. 365, NLS Acc. 12695/26c);
Gifted to his daughter, Mary Stewart Lockhart (1894-1985);
Presented by the above to George Watson’s College, Edinburgh in 1967;
Lent to the National Museums of Scotland, Edinburgh (2003-2025).
Exihibition:
Edinburgh, City Art Centre, An Ardent Collector, December 1982 / January 1983, catalogue no. 58.
